It is an exciting time to join us at Lancashire and South Cumbria NHS Foundation Trust. We are looking for Band 5 Mental Health Nurse to join us in our inpatient services.

Kentmere Ward is situated at Westmorland General Hospital in Kendal and is a 12 bedded mental health unit offering short-term recovery-based care, focused to meet the needs of individuals with mental health issues. This enables people to return to their communities, and allows them to regain their independence.

We are looking for caring, empathetic, enthusiastic individuals who have a passion to improve the lives of our patients. These roles will be to provide care and support to patients who require mental health interventions, guidance or monitoring.

To work as part of a multi-disciplinary team (M.D.T.) to develop person centred holistic care. Maintaining individual’s quality of life while assessing them for appropriate community placements. This job also entails taking responsibility for the day to day management of the ward as required in support of the ward manager and deputies, including teaching, supervision of junior staff/students. This will also include managing a team within the named nurse model and all aspects regarding the delivery of care. The position requires shift work, including occasional nights, on a rotational basis.
